What happens when arabinose is present in the system?

Explanation:
Arabinose acts as an inducer for the arabinose-regulated expression system. When arabinose is present, it binds to the AraC protein and changes AraC’s shape so it promotes transcription rather than blocking it. This enables RNA polymerase to initiate transcription from the pBAD promoter, leading to expression of the downstream rfp gene and production of red fluorescent protein. Without arabinose, AraC represses transcription at this promoter, so rfp is not expressed.
